A beautiful double-calcite on quartz from a one-off pocket at the Borieva Mine in Bulgaria! This pocket was discovered in late July of 2017. There are two large calcite crystals growing on top of each other forming a curved chain. In back of the calcite crystals is a bed of finger-like quartz crystals with green chlorite inclusions. The scalenohedral calcite crystals are yellow-amber color, and are comprised of hundreds of flattened, stacked rhombohedrons. A highly aesthetic, beautiful, and unique specimen! This is one of the finest Illinois fluorite specimens that we have ever had for sale! It is absolutely exquisite! There are two fluorite corners growing from a shared stalk that has been partially dissolutioned away. The fluorite has extremely sharp and clear phantoms with a yellow core followed by a thin purple zone and then the blue outer zone. There are two white, round barite balls embedded in the yellow zone just poking through the purple zone. The outer zones are so glassy that light goes right through to the barite balls giving them a very 3D appearance of floating inside of the fluorite crystal.

There are many forms of calcite mineral specimens in the world, but none so immediately identifyable as the multigenerational twinned calcites from the Palmarejo Mine in Mexico. One look at these and you know exactly what it is and where it came from because there are no other calcite specimens in the world that look anything like this!

These specimens first started appearing in 2014, but most hit the market in 2017. Even then it was unclear exactly what these were, so most dealers labled them simply as calcite. Recent reseach, however, has revealed exactly what these are and how they formed, and there is an entire article with all of the details in the Sept/Oct 2018 Issue of Rocks & Minerals magazine. According to this research these specimens started as elongated "fish-tail" twinned calcite crystals. Later, more layers of manganese rich calcite were deposited. After this is when things got interesting because there was a uni-directional flow in the cavity where these formed, and this caused a thin, white layer of Palygorskite to form just on one side of the specimen - the side facing the flow. It seems that nothing else could grow on top of the Palygorskite, so subsequent generations of minerals were only deposited on the uncoated surfaces. The thin black layer you see around the white palygorskite is Romanechite, and then after that a new layer of clear/brown calcite was deposited.

N'chwaning rhodochrosite specimens are the most sought after rhodochrosites in the world and large specimens of good quality are extremely rare. This one is not only an excellent size, but it has the extra benefit of being heart-shaped which is quite approprite for such a red mineral specimen. This is the wheat sheaf habit of rhodochrosite crystals, and they're growing on a matrix of black manganite. There are also black manganite specks mixed in with the rhodochrosite, and also some quartz deep in the crevices between the individual rhodochorisite crystals.
